Transaction 072e6bb1590f8167f4e89608b488eaddbb968a1045da638f1c1ddb31d75f59a3

100 Input
1 Outputs
  • 072e6bb1590f8167f4e89608b488eaddbb968a1045da638f1c1ddb31d75f59a3:0
  • value  339801180
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h